Within the framework of SPEED 98, Japan Environment Agency conducted PLC and/or FLC with 28 of 67 chemicals listed [3]. The results showed that only 3 chemicals, i.e., 4-nonylphenol, 4-t-octylphenol, and bisphenol A were suggested as EDCs. We also conducted sex reversal assay or PLC test (56-day exposure) to evaluate the effects of some pesticides (malathion, benomyl, cypermethrin, permethrin, esfenvalerate, fenvalerate) listed in SPEED 98. The results showed that these pesticides gave no endocrine-disrupting effects even at one-seventh to one-twentieth of the acute toxicity values (Table III). The effect of benomyl on hatchability is likely to be caused by inhibition of cell division. Based on these findings, it is unlikely that these chemicals listed affected as EDCs. [Pg.419]

Within the USEPA s EPI Suite, descriptions of basic physical-chemical properties for 2,4-dichloroaniline (DCA CAS No. 554007), pentachlorophenol (PCP CAS No. 87865), nonylphenol (NP CAS No. 104405), and linear alkylbenzenesulfonate (C12 LAS CAS No. 25155300) were obtained using the EPI Suite (Table 3.1), whereas acute and chronic toxicity estimates for the median effective and chronic effect concentrations (the geometric mean between chronic lowest-observed-effect concentration [LOEC] and no-observed-effect concentration [NOEC]) and for fish, daphnids, and algae for each substance were estimated from ECOSAR (Table 3.2). These compounds were chosen based on their widespread use. [Pg.91]
